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Anzeige
Inhaltsverzeichnis

zählen wenn der gleiche wert in einer Spalte

Forumthread: zählen wenn der gleiche wert in einer Spalte

zählen wenn der gleiche wert in einer Spalte
01.09.2025 15:27:26
Matthias
Hallo zusammen,

ich habe in einer Spalte verschiedene Personalnummern manche mehrfach, und möchte wissen wie oft jede Personalnummer in der Spalte existiert.
Hatte es jetzt damit versucht =SUMME(1/countif(E2:E242; E2:E242)), da kam nur #Name? als Ergebnis.

Vielen Dank!

Anzeige

10
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: zählen wenn der gleiche wert in einer Spalte
01.09.2025 15:29:53
SF
Hola,
#NAME kommt weil du countif in der Formel stehen hast.
Aber bei der Beschreibung sollte doch nur Zählenwenn() ausreichen.
Gruß,
steve1da
AW: zählen wenn der gleiche wert in einer Spalte
01.09.2025 17:23:19
{Boris}
Hi,

ein bisserl länger, aber dafür (in Deiner Excelversion) sicher performanter:

=LET(x;EINDEUTIG(E2:E242);ANZAHL2(EINDEUTIG(FILTER(x;x>0))))

VG, Boris
Anzeige
AW: zählen wenn der gleiche wert in einer Spalte
01.09.2025 18:52:05
Luschi
Hallo Matthias,

das ist doch eine typische Anwendung für: =GRUPPIERENNACH(tab_PNr[P_Nr];tab_PNr[P_Nr];ANZAHL2)

Gruß von Luschi
aus klein-Paris
In der Excelversion...
02.09.2025 15:32:44
Case
Moin Matthias, :-)

... 365 gibt es die Funktion "PIVOTMIT": ;-)
https://support.microsoft.com/de-de/office/pivotmit-funktion-de86516a-90ad-4ced-8522-3a25fac389cf

Die Formel spillt - du brauchst also nach unten und nach rechts genug Platz, sonst kommt der Fehler "#ÜBERLAUF!". ;-)

Da kannst du sowas nehmen: ;-)
=PIVOTMIT(E2:.E500;;E2:.E500;ANZAHL2)

Oder ohne Gesamt am Schluß: ;-)
=PIVOTMIT(E2:.E500;;E2:.E500;ANZAHL2;;0)

Wenn das mit den Punkten (also der Punkt jeweils vor .E500) bei dir nicht funktioniert, gib den Bereich richtig an (im deutsch Excel ist es "ABSCHNBEREICH"). ;-)
https://support.microsoft.com/de-de/office/trimrange-funktion-d7812248-3bc5-4c6b-901c-1afa9564f999

Servus
Case
Anzeige
AW: In der Excelversion...
02.09.2025 20:29:11
Luschi
Hallo Excel-Fan's,

mit ein bißchen mehr Aufwand kann man auch die Anzahl in Prozent berechnen.
=VSTAPELN({"PNr."."Anzahl"."Anzahl %"};

WEGLASSEN(PIVOTMIT(E2:.E500;;E2:.E500;HSTAPELN(ANZAHL2;LAMBDA(x;y;ANZAHL2(x)/ANZAHL2(y))));1))

Leider schweigt sich die E-365-Hilfe dazu aus, daß bei GruppierenNach() und PivotMit() 2 Parameter an eingesetzte Lambda-Fkt. übergeben werden; in meinem Beispiel x und y.
Wie man diese Parameter benennt ist schnurzpiepegal, man muß nur wissen, das der 1. Parameter (bei mir 'x') die Werte der Gruppierung und der 2. Parameter ('y') alle Werte der gruppierten Spalte beinhalten.
So ist es auch möglich, Anzahl2 durch Lambda() zu ersetzen (siehe unterstrichene Teilbereiche der Formeln).
=VSTAPELN({"PNr."."Anzahl"."Anzahl %"};

WEGLASSEN(PIVOTMIT(C4:.C500;;C4:.C500;HSTAPELN(LAMBDA(x;y;ANZAHL2(x));LAMBDA(x;y;ANZAHL2(x)/ANZAHL2(y))));1))

Gruß von Luschi
aus klein-Paris
Anzeige
AW: und warum nicht ganz ohne Formel? Einfach pivotieren owT
01.09.2025 21:12:15
neopa C
Gruß Werner
.. , - ...
aus C the unseen
AW: und warum nicht ganz ohne Formel? Einfach pivotieren owT
02.09.2025 12:33:24
Luschi
Hallo Werner,

Pivottabelle: das ist mir viel zu viel Maus-Klickerei.

Gruß von Luschi
aus klein-Paris
AW: meist aber einfacher zu erstellen & sehr flexibel owT
02.09.2025 13:11:26
neopa C
Gruß Werner
.. , - ...
aus C the unseen
Anzeige
AW: meist aber einfacher zu erstellen & sehr flexibel owT
02.09.2025 13:12:59
Patrick
Danke für den Tipp zu Power Query. Ich schau mir demnach ein paar Tutorials an, wie das zu erstellen ist.
AW: Dein Beitrag war für einen anderen thread vorgesehen owT
02.09.2025 13:22:50
neopa C
Gruß Werner
.. , - ...
aus C the unseen
Anzeige
Anzeige
Live-Forum - Die aktuellen Beiträge
Datum
Titel
14.05.2026 13:31:09
14.05.2026 09:50:42
13.05.2026 19:14:18